cnc machining center Modern metrology employs sophisticated equipment like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MM), optical comparators, and laser scanners. These tools move beyond simple caliper checks, capturing complex 3D geometries, surface profiles, and internal features with micronlevel accuracy. The real power, however, lies in the process. First Article Inspection (FAI) provides a comprehensive validation against all drawing specifications before full production runs. Inprocess inspection monitors critical dimensions throughout machining, allowing for realtime adjustments and preventing costly batch errors. Finally, final inspection delivers certified documentation, often with full traceability, proving every part meets the required standards, whether they are ISO, AS9100, or specific customer protocols.
